2.5.4 JaCkIng<br />

When jacking your car up off the ground a safe, stable, load rated support device must be used. The use of<br />

crates, piles of wood, or four strong team members, is NOT ALLOWED.<br />

2.5.5 RunnIng EngInEs (fsC only)<br />

You are allowed to run engines ONLY in the designated engine test area, manned by official marshals. This may<br />

only be done during the opening times, after passing scrutineering! Engines may not be run in the pit garage!<br />

Even in the engine test area, there are several guidelines to follow in terms of safety. Please read these guidelines<br />

in chapter 3.1.5 attentively.<br />

2.5.6 sETTIng THE TRaCTIVE sysTEM aCTIVE (fsE only)<br />

Any time the tractive system is activated a safety responsible (SR) must be involved.<br />

The activation of the tractive system in the dynamic area requires the explicit approval of an FSG official.<br />

The activation of the tractive system or the spinning of motors in the pit is only permitted if the car is jacked up<br />

and the driven wheels are demounted. Please also see the guidelines in section 2.5.3.<br />

2.5.7 fIREs anD sMokIng<br />

No open fires are allowed in the pit area and in the engine test area. This includes BBQ grilles, oxy-acelylene<br />

torches, heaters, cigarettes, etc. Smoking is strictly prohibited in the dynamic area, in all buildings, and in the<br />

pit area. Smoking is permitted only in the area around the grandstands and in between event control and the<br />

BW Tower.<br />

2.5.8 WElDIng<br />

FSG provides an approved welder. Welding is allowed in the designated welding area only. Welding will be provided<br />

at the following times:<br />

Wed 1 August 14:00 – 18:00<br />

Thu 2 August 09:00 – 18:00<br />

Fri 3 August 09:00 – 18:00<br />

Sat 4 August 09:00 – 18:00<br />

Sun 5 August 09:00 – 18:00<br />

2.5.9 TyREs<br />

FSG provides a tyre changing service. The opening hours of the Continental truck:<br />

Thu 2 August 08:00 – 19:00<br />

Fri 3 August 08:00 – 19:00<br />

Sat 4 August 08:00 – 19:00<br />

Sun 5 August 08:00 – 19:00<br />

2.5.10 fuEl anD oIl<br />

Open fuel containers are not permitted at the event. All fuel containers must be DOT approved. Waste oil is to<br />

be taken to the fuel station for disposal. Refuelling is only allowed at the fuel station.
